Super BERRY - CRANBERRY 🔴
Perfect for making smoothies, salads, and sauces for dishes, add to stews, and use in healthy desserts
🔴Cranberries, rich in vitamins, help combat avitaminosis and strengthen blood due to their trace elements.
🔴These berries can also suppress inflammation.
🔴Hundreds of studies have shown that biologically active substances in cranberries improve health.
🔴For example, polyphenols in cranberries have been shown to support a healthy urinary system and protect against cardiovascular diseases and other chronic ailments.
🔴In addition to protecting the urinary system and cardiovascular health, cranberries are considered to help suppress the development of malignant tumors and protect against certain forms of cancer. Furthermore, the same polyphenols that protect the urinary system from bacteria also remove them from the oral mucosa and teeth.
🔴Cranberries are also rich in vitamin C, as well as vitamins B1, B2, E, P, and minerals such as magnesium, phosphorus, calcium, potassium, iodine, iron, copper, and manganese. A total of 25 chemical elements have been identified in the composition of cranberries.
